Notification has been released for the recruitment of Navik (General Duty), Navik (Domestic Branch) jobs through Coast Guard Enrolled personal Test (CGEPT)-02/2025 batch. Only male candidates should apply for these posts. You can apply online by 25th of this month (Feb 20th).
How many posts?
Total posts (300), Navik (General Duty) 260
Regions (North -65, West-53. East-38, South -54, Central – 50),
Navik (Domestic Branch): 40
Regions (North-10, West-09, East-05, South-09, Central-17)
What are the qualifications?
For Navik General posts, 12th Class (Maths/Physics) should be passed,
For Navik Domestic Branch posts, 10th Class should be passed.
Should be born between September 1, 2003 and August 28, 2007. That is, between 18 and 22 years of age. There is a relaxation of three years for OBCs and five years for SC and ST.
How to apply?
Apply online. Exam Fees: Rs. 300, SC/ST candidates are exempted.
How is selection done?
Selection will be done on the basis of Stage-1, Stage-2, Stage-3, Stage-4 exams, medical test, and certificate verification.
Officer Jobs in INA
Indian Naval Academy in Kerala has issued a notification for the recruitment of Short Service Commission Officer posts. Eligible male candidates can apply by 25th of this month.
Which posts?
Education 15, Naval constructor 18, Air Traffic Controller 18, Naval Air Operations Officer 22, Logistics 28, Pilot 26, Engineering Branch 38, Electrical Branch 45, Executive Branch 60 posts will be filled.
What are the qualifications?
Depending on the posts, a degree (B.Sc., B.Com), PG (MCA, MSc.), BE., B.Tech in the relevant discipline should be passed along with work experience.
